Product Details

Sometimes the path we take to get where we are going isn’t as straightforward as we expected. Why not embrace it and enjoy traveling that crooked path? This is a sideways asymmetrical triangle-shaped shawl pattern with crooked lines of eyelets to break up the garter stitch body. It’s completely reversible. When knitted with a beautiful hand dyed fingering weight yarn, the end result is a light and airy one-skein shawl to help you travel that path in the most stylish of ways.

This pattern uses one skein of Malabrigo Mechita and the colour shown here is Dried Orange. Pattern includes list of abbreviations, diagram, and written instructions.

Finished measurements: Approximately 19 inches (49 cm) wide at middle and 60 inches (152 cm) long, blocked.

Skills required: increasing, decreasing, picot bind-off, blocking. Stitches used: k, p, kfb, k2tog, SKP, yo.
